More About Barefoot Books
Barefoot Books is a passionate publishing company which aims to ignite children's imaginations, and encourage children to explore and respect the planet and other cultures. At their Concord location, across from the train depot, Barefoot Books has their newly opened flagship store and community center. Inside is a colorful and bright space, with a story-telling area, reading cubby, window benches and chairs, and a room for crafts, yoga and other community activities. On sale are beautiful, long-lasting books, CDs and gifts for children, carefully crafted by Barefoot Books. The company was founded in 1992 by two mothers, Tessa Strickland and Nancy Traversy, and operates worldwide in a global community.
